Job DetailsResposibilities:
- Manages a team of individuals and vendors to provide support to application security programs inclusive of remediation strategies and efforts to protect infrastructure and 3rd party application vulnerabilities
- Oversees the planning, execution, and management of security engagements related to functional area of responsibility.
- Develops key critical reports to be presented on vulnerabilities to stakeholders and serves as a subject matter expert (SME) for ISO programs
- Advises strategic and tactical direction and consultation on security initiatives and provides support and collaboration to ensure organizational objectives are met
- Develops, refines and implements enterprise-wide security policies, procedures, and standards across multiple platform and application environments to meet internal and external compliance responsibilities
- Supports documentation and tracking of policies, procedures, standards and system configurations and recommends and implements changes as necessary
- Participates in goals/KPIs setting, budget creation and performance management of Information Security Strategy team
- Leads security team in validating and evidence gathering for escalated security incidents and identifies root cause for application and/or network-related security issues and advises on remediation options
- Contributes to the review of internal processes and activities and assists in identifying potential opportunities for improvement and further automation
- Provides technical/management leadership on assignments and acts as a SME; provides technical and business process responses during training as required
- Ensures technical and business alignment with other team members or departments including information security project design, implementation or monitoring, research and development on new processes and procedures for best practices
- Coordinates, organizes and reports on application development, and infrastructure implementation and maintenance of various security initiatives
- Leads the strategy, design, engineering and implementation of robust security strategies, frameworks, platforms, and solutions
- Provides vision and leadership for the organization's overall cybersecurity processes and culture
- Carries out the development, review, implementation, and maintenance of the organization's security guiding documentation and manages the services and relationship with research and enterprise security teams to develop joint processes and procedures
- Helps the company improve information security and helps design and implement information security programs that can keep pace with the ever-changing security requirements
- Provides leadership over corporate business resiliency, which includes business/service continuity planning, business impact management, and disaster recovery measures
- Leads the strategy, design, engineering and implementation of robust security strategies, frameworks, platforms, and solutions
- Leads a high-performing team for designing, building, testing and implementing security solutions and also assists the overall IT risk & compliance team in maintaining user population and reviewing reports related to accounting activity

EDUCATIONAL QUALIFICATIONS:
- Master’s Degree in Business Administration, Computer Science, Information Technology or any other related discipline or equivalent related experience.
Preferred Certifications:
- Certified Information Systems Auditor (CISA)
- Certified Information Systems Security Professional (CISSP)
- Certification in Information Security Strategy Management (CISM)
- Information Technology Infrastructure Library (ITIL)
- Offensive Security Certified Professional (OSCP)
- Project Management Professional (PMP) Certification
WORK EXPERIENCE:
- 7+ years of directly-related or relevant experience with 3+ years in a managerial capacity, preferably in information security.
